The Art of Silhouette and Fabric
The foundation of any elegant outfit lies in the understanding of silhouette. A well-defined silhouette flatters the figure and creates a harmonious visual balance. Whether it’s the classic A-line dress, the tailored fit of a blazer, or the flowing drape of a wide-leg trouser, the shape of a garment significantly impacts its overall aesthetic. Choosing silhouettes that complement your body type is crucial, but equally important is understanding how different fabrics interact with those shapes. A structured fabric like linen or cotton will maintain a sharp silhouette, while a softer fabric like silk or jersey will create a more fluid and relaxed look. The interplay between silhouette and fabric is where true artistry in fashion begins to emerge. Finding pieces where these two elements work in synergy can dramatically elevate your style.
Understanding Fabric Weights and Textures
Fabric weight and texture play a significant role in how a garment feels and looks. Heavier fabrics, such as wool and tweed, are perfect for cooler weather and offer a sense of warmth and sophistication. Lighter fabrics, like chiffon and linen, are ideal for warmer climates and create a breezy, effortless aesthetic. Texture adds another layer of dimension to an outfit. Consider incorporating fabrics with subtle textures, such as ribbed knits or embossed patterns, to add visual interest. Understanding these nuances allows you to build a wardrobe that’s not only stylish but also appropriate for different seasons and occasions. High-quality fabrics are essential for long-lasting elegance.
| Linen | Light to Medium | Summer Clothing, Casual Wear | Machine wash cold, tumble dry low |
| Silk | Light | Evening Wear, Delicate Blouses | Dry Clean Only |
| Wool | Medium to Heavy | Winter Coats, Suits | Dry Clean or Hand Wash |
| Cotton | Light to Medium | Everyday Wear, Breathable Clothing | Machine Washable |
Investing in pieces made from high-quality fabrics ensures that your wardrobe will not only look good but also withstand the test of time. Fabrics really are key to obtaining a timeless aesthetic.
Color Palettes and Timeless Neutrals
Building a wardrobe around a carefully curated color palette is a cornerstone of elegant style. While bold colors can certainly make a statement, a foundation of timeless neutrals offers versatility and sophistication. Colors such as black, navy, gray, beige, and white serve as the building blocks for countless outfits. These neutrals can be effortlessly mixed and matched, creating a sense of cohesion and ease. Introducing pops of color through accessories or statement pieces can add personality and visual interest, but maintaining a base of neutrals ensures that your wardrobe remains classic and adaptable. Thinking in terms of a coordinated palette simplifies the process of putting together outfits and minimizes the risk of clashing combinations.
The Psychology of Color in Fashion
Color psychology suggests that different colors evoke different emotions and create different impressions. Navy blue, for example, is often associated with trust and authority, making it a popular choice for professional attire. Gray conveys a sense of sophistication and neutrality, while beige offers a warm and inviting aesthetic. Understanding the psychological impact of color can help you make informed decisions about what you wear. Consider your personal style and the message you want to convey when choosing colors for your wardrobe. Carefully selecting colors is an often overlooked element of style.
- Black: Represents sophistication, power, and elegance.
- Navy: Conveys trustworthiness and professionalism.
- Gray: Offers a sense of neutrality and sophistication.
- Beige: Creates a warm and inviting aesthetic.
- White: Symbolizes purity and freshness.

The Importance of Tailoring and Fit
No matter how expensive or well-designed a garment may be, it will never look its best if it doesn’t fit properly. Tailoring is the secret weapon of the stylish individual. A well-tailored garment flatters the figure, enhances comfort, and exudes an air of confidence. Investing in tailoring can transform even basic pieces into something truly special. A slightly too-long hemline, a loosely fitted waist, or an ill-fitting shoulder can all detract from the overall look of an outfit. Finding a skilled tailor who understands your body type and style preferences is a valuable investment. The better the fit, the more confident you will feel.
